Metabolic profiling of bioactive compounds from different medicinal plants: An overview

Abstract

Metabolomics has become an important tool in many research areas like drug discovery, diseases and nutrition, plant physiology, food quality and authenticity assessment, biomarker discovery, environmental and biological-stress studies, functional genomics, integrative systems biology, etc. It can be targeted or non-targeted. Metabolomics has been used as a vast tool for the investigation and quality measurement and assessment of natural products derived from plant and its parts. However, metabolite profiling in crude extracts is not an easy work as natural materials show a very diverse form of structure. It makes use of various analytical techniques like LC-QTOF-MS, GC-QTOF-MS, UPLC-QTOFMS, LC-ESI-QTOF/MS. In the present review, an attempt has been done to enlist metabolic profiling of 50 medicinal plants, along with their part, solvent used and number of bioactive compounds identified. Its various uses have also been discussed.
